Avid Media Composer
Video, Photography and Film Production
Avid Media Composer is a professional non-linear video editing software used extensively in film and television post-production for tasks like assembling footage, color correction, and sound editing. It has been an industry standard for decades, used by editors on major Hollywood films and network television shows for its robust media management and collaborative editing features.
